STM32F103C8T6移植FreeRTOS无法运行

2019-07-21 04:44发布

最近刚学习FreeRTOS,照着原子哥的的移植过程移植在自己的STM32F103C8T6板子上,但是板子没有反应,但不调试了也一直卡在图一那个位置,全部也都初始化了的,请各位前辈看看是哪里设置问题还是我自己的程序位置,附件为源程序,
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
14条回答
way7539512
2019-07-21 19:20
wangzw 发表于 2018-3-27 20:47
哥们,我也是这个问题,能说下具体怎么解决的吗

在stm32f10x_it.c里面把  SVC_Handler      PendSV_Handler       SysTick_Handler    这3个函数注释掉,然后在freertosconfig.h里面定义这几个
#define vPortSVCHandler      SVC_Handler
#define xPortPendSVHandler   PendSV_Handler
//#define xPortSysTickHandler  SysTick_Handler

就可以了,时钟这个不清楚为什么定义了就会出错(我用了原子哥的system),不定义一切正常,希望加个好友,可以一起学习,如果知道为啥不定义或者需要新的定义务必告诉我一下,谢谢

一周热门 更多>